You need strong programming skills in languages like Python, C++, or ROS, knowledge of robotics frameworks, mechanical and electrical engineering fundamentals, and problem-solving abilities. Collaboration, communication, and proficiency in simulation tools are also important for remote work.
Typically, a degree in robotics, computer science, mechanical engineering, or a related field is required. Relevant experience with robotics projects and a strong portfolio showcasing your work can be equally valuable. Certifications in robotics or related technologies may enhance your qualifications.
Responsibilities include designing and implementing robotic systems, coding algorithms for robot behavior, testing and debugging hardware and software, collaborating with other engineers, and maintaining documentation. You will also need to ensure safety and compliance with industry standards.
Benefits include flexibility in work location and hours, reduced commuting stress, the opportunity to work on innovative technology, and a chance to collaborate with global teams. Remote work in robotics can also offer a better work-life balance and access to diverse projects.
